4. Struggling To Balance Work-Life Commitments While Running A Business

Starting a business can be time-consuming and can often mean sacrificing your own personal time. Finding the right balance between work and life commitments is essential to ensure you don’t burn out or become overwhelmed. This may require setting boundaries, such as having regular days off or taking breaks during long working hours.

Creating a schedule that works for you and your employees is also essential. It may mean implementing flexible working hours or using technology such as video conferencing that allows for remote collaboration. Additionally, it’s necessary to ensure that all team members get adequate rest and downtime to stay productive and happy.

Finally, delegating tasks whenever possible is essential so you don’t take on a workload that is too large. Making sure you have the right support system can make all the difference in staying organized, productive, and stress-free.

5. Having Ineffective Marketing Strategies

Most marketing strategies are designed to increase brand awareness, generate leads, and drive sales. However, having an ineffective marketing strategy can be a major setback for businesses. One of the most common mistakes business owners make is not targeting the right audience. When developing your marketing plan, take the time to research who your ideal customer is and what their needs and behaviors are so you can tailor your message accordingly.

It’s also important to invest in tracking tools that measure performance so you can understand how successful (or unsuccessful) your campaigns have been. This will allow you to identify where changes need to be made or areas where more investment needs to be allocated. Finally, it’s essential to stay on top of trends in digital marketing and use the right channels to reach your target market. This could include creating content for social media platforms or utilizing email campaigns to engage with potential customers.
